Note
If the LCD status panel shows a countdown when you turn on the camera, it means the cam-
era is erasing all pictures from the memory.This happens when the camera was not properly
shut off or the power was suddenly terminated while the camera was erasing pictures.

Using the Power Adapter

If you do not want to use batteries with your
digital camera, you can operate the camera
on standard AC power. Simply connect the
provided 5.0V/2.5A power adapter to your
camera. You can buy this optional item from
the authorized dealer.
1. Flip the rubber cover open on the camera's
s i d e . Yo u w i l l t h e n s e e a s e r i e s o f
connectors, one of which is the power port.
2. Connect the power adapter's cord to your
camera's power port.
3. Then, connect the power adapter into a wall
outlet.
4. You can now turn on the camera's power.
Just press the POWER button on the back
of your camera.
Note
Use only the supplied adapter. Any other adapter may cause damage to the camera and
voids the warranty.
Grasp the power adapter, not the cord, when unplugging it from a wall socket.
If the power cord is damaged (exposed or severed wires, etc.), please purchase a new AC
adapter. Using a damaged cord may cause fire or electrical shock.
Switch off and disconnect the camera from the AC adapter before unplugging it from the
wall socket.

Auto Power Off

The camera is equipped with an automatic power off function. It switches off auto-
matically when there are no operations performed for over 120 seconds. To restore full
power, press the POWER button on the back.
